Gossip: Lindsay Lohan
Will Lohan complete 480 hours of community service by next April?
Lindsay Lohan isn’t rushing to complete her community service, said RadarOnline.com. Friends of the actress are worried that she is working and partying too many late nights instead of buckling down on court requirements. Lohan has until next April to complete 380 hours of community service at a women’s shelter and 100 hours at the Los Angeles County Morgue. Lohan has completed only 60 hours at the shelter and “hasn’t done any time at the morgue,” says a source. “If she was smart, she would work to get those hours done.”
